What is a Mental Health Assessment?
A mental health assessment is a structured process for evaluating an individual's mental well-being. It is carried out by a certified mental health professional and involves gathering info on the individual's emotion, behaviors, and potential mental health conditions. Assessment techniques can consist of interviews, surveys, and psychological tests.

Recommendation and Preparation:
Typically begins with a referral from a medical care physician or a mental health expert. Patients need to prepare by thinking of their signs, emotional experiences, and any pertinent history.
Initial Interview:
A clinician carries out a thorough interview to collect information regarding symptoms, family history, medical history, and any substance abuse issues.
Standardized Assessment Tools:
The clinician might make use of surveys and standardized tests to assess particular locations, such as mood, anxiety, and cognitive functions.
Behavioral Observations:
Observations during the interview can provide insight into the person's behavior, body language, and emotion.
Feedback and Recommendations:

Why are mental health assessments crucial?
Mental health assessments are essential for recognizing mental issues early, producing customized treatment strategies, keeping track of progress, and helping with communication between clients and experts.
2. The length of time does a mental health assessment take?
The length of an assessment can differ. A common assessment may take 1 to 2 hours, however more intricate evaluations may need several sessions.
3. Are mental health assessments private?
Yes, [mental health assessments](https://ville.angaliya.com/author-profile/mental-health-assesment6284/) are personal. Clinicians are obliged to maintain personal privacy unless there is a threat of harm to the patient or others.
4. Who carries out mental health assessments?
Certified professionals such as psychologists, psychiatrists, and licensed scientific social workers generally conduct mental health assessments.
5. What takes place if a mental health condition is identified?
If a mental health condition is diagnosed, the clinician will talk about possible treatment options, which might include treatment, medication, or lifestyle changes, customized to the person's needs.
